Key Biscayne's island location means near-constant salt exposure and wind load, we see faster hardware wear here than almost anywhere else on the mainland side of Miami-Dade.
Expect large impact-rated balcony sliders in Key Biscayne's condo towers near Crandon Park, alongside single-family homes in the Village Green area with sizable patio sliders facing the water.
Island exposure means we generally recommend stainless-bearing hardware even for a standard repair here, standard parts corrode noticeably faster this close to open water on all sides.
